The best time for hiking and mountain biking in Seattle is during the summer months (June to August) when the weather is generally sunny and dry. For kayaking and sailing, late spring to early fall offers mild temperatures and calm waters, while winter (December to February) is ideal for skiing and snowboarding at nearby resorts in Seattle like Stevens Pass. Rain gear is essential for fall and winter outings as Seattle experiences significant rainfall.

Discover a city that beautifully blends urban sophistication with the scenic beauty of the Pacific Northwest. With its iconic Space Needle piercing the skyline and the picturesque backdrop of Mount Rainier, Seattle is a traveler's dream. Explore the vibrant Pike Place Market, home to artisanal foods and the famous flying fish, or take a leisurely stroll along the waterfront. Art and culture thrive here, from the Museum of Pop Culture to the Seattle Art Museum. Whether you're drawn to the lush greenery of Discovery Park or the bustling atmosphere of the Ballard Locks, Seattle promises an unforgettable experience at every turn.
